Summary
Airbus S.A.S. (Airbus) is a commercial aircraft manufacturer. The company is a wholly owned subsidiary of European Aeronautic Defense and Space Company (EADS). The company has operations in Americas, Europe, Africa, the Middle East and Asia-Pacific. The company is engaged in manufacturing and selling aircrafts under the brands A320, A350, A300/ A310, A330/A340, and A380. In addition, the company is also engaged in manufacturing private and executive jets namely: Beluga (A300-600ST super transporter) and A400M airlifter.
